不小心执行了 chmod 777 -R

2019-12-25 17:23:52 +08:00
 cruii
今天没有注意所在目录直接敲了个 chmod 777 -R
把 /usr/local/下的目录全改了
有没有办法弄回去啊,看着好难受啊
3497 次点击
所在节点    程序员
8 条回复
julyclyde
2019-12-25 17:26:13 +08:00
/usr/local 都是自己编译的内容
你重新编译一遍就行了
cruii
2019-12-25 17:36:49 +08:00
系统是 macOS 10.15.2
index90
2019-12-25 17:38:54 +08:00
拿别人的系统,对着重新设一遍
lrvy
2019-12-25 17:39:46 +08:00
haozxuan001
2019-12-25 18:20:57 +08:00
我理解,改大了好像并不会影响什么
263
2019-12-25 19:20:57 +08:00
目录
find /usr/local -type d -exec chmod 755 {} \;

文件
find /usr/local -type f -exec chmod 644 {} \;

可执行
find /usr/local -type f -name "*.sh" -exec chmod +x {} \;
hualuogeng
2019-12-25 19:59:04 +08:00
@haozxuan001 安全
laibin6
2019-12-25 20:09:00 +08:00
mac 不是还有加个 sudo 才行吗

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/632255

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X